Tim Hortons’ Smile Cookies funding new Prescott arena this week

An annual fundraising event is going towards the Alaine Chartrand Arena and Recreation Complex this year.

Tim Hortons’ yearly Smile Cookies campaign has returned this week. 

Cookies cost one dollar each, and all proceeds from the Prescott location are going towards the new facility.

Last year’s Smile Cookie campaign, benefitting the South Grenville Food Bank, brought in more than $13,000 for the organization.

The arena, named after Prescott-raised two-time national figure skating champion Alaine Chartrand, has been in the works since before the pandemic, with ground broken at the construction site last July.

You’ll be able to purchase the cookies until Sunday, September 25th.
